The Final Year of the Acura RLX


The Acura RLX was officially discontinued after the 2020 model year. Acura decided to phase out the RLX as part of a strategic shift to focus more on SUVs and crossovers, which have become increasingly popular among consumers. The 2020 Acura RLX marked the end of the line for this luxury sedan, offering a refined driving experience and advanced features for its final iteration.


Why Was the Acura RLX Discontinued?


Several factors contributed to the discontinuation of the Acura RLX:



  • Declining Sedan Sales: The automotive market has seen a significant shift in consumer preferences, with SUVs and crossovers dominating sales. Sedans like the RLX have struggled to maintain their market share.

  • Focus on SUVs: Acura, like many automakers, has chosen to prioritize its SUV lineup, including popular models like the Acura MDX and RDX, to meet consumer demand.

  • Competition: The luxury sedan segment is highly competitive, with strong contenders from brands like BMW, Mercedes-Benz, and Lexus. The RLX faced challenges in standing out in this crowded market.

Why was RLX discontinued?


Acura has announced it is discontinuing its top-end sedan after the 2020 model year. Why? you ask. One reason could be that the RLX, which starts at $55,925, found only 179 buyers in the first quarter of this year.

Is Acura just a fancy Honda?


Acura is the luxury and performance division of Japanese automaker Honda, based primarily in North America. The brand was launched on March 27, 1986, marketing luxury and performance automobiles. Acura sells cars in the United States, Canada, Mexico, Panama, and Kuwait.
